WebThe gaussian pulse can be described by, (3) where τ is a measure of the pulse width. The spectrum of this gaussian pulse, denoted ē in (ω), also has a gaussian profile, and can be written. (4) These two profiles are illustrated in Figure 2, where both the 1/e and half-maximum widths are identified. The pulse has a full width at 1/e of 2τ ...
